Cladding Painting in Longmont, CO
Cladding painting services involve applying fresh coats of paint to the exterior coverings of a property, such as vinyl, wood, metal, or fiber cement cladding. This service is often requested for projects aiming to enhance curb appeal, protect the building from weather elements, or update the overall appearance of a home or commercial property. Property owners typically seek cladding painting when their existing exterior surfaces show signs of aging, fading, or damage, or when a new color or finish is desired to better match their aesthetic preferences.
Before requesting cladding painting services, property owners should consider the condition of the existing cladding, including whether it requires repairs or preparation work like cleaning or sanding. It is also important to understand the types of paint suitable for different materials and the impact of weather conditions on the project. Clarifying the scope of work, including surface preparation, paint selection, and any necessary repairs, can help ensure the final result meets expectations and provides long-lasting protection for the building.

Cladding Painting Questions
What types of cladding can be painted? Cladding materials such as wood, vinyl, fiber cement, and metal can typically be painted to refresh their appearance and protect surfaces.
Is cladding painting suitable for all property types? Yes, cladding painting is appropriate for residential, commercial, and multi-family properties looking to update or maintain exterior surfaces.
What should property owners consider before painting cladding? It's important to ensure the surface is clean, dry, and in good condition to achieve a durable and even finish.
How often should cladding be repainted? Repainting intervals depend on material and exposure, but generally, cladding may need a fresh coat every 5 to 10 years for optimal protection and appearance.
